And AP’S spin: This is missing context. Edison Research, the polling company that gives election data to the news outlet, announced an information reporting error by staffers led the fake votes to briefly show on a live CNN newscast. The error was fixed in two minutes.

The real facts: Within hours of Governor Newsom handily beating the recall effort on Tuesday, social media users started sharing a video of someone watching CNN on election night, saying it showed real-time manipulation.

The clip, which spread via, Telegram, Gab, Twitter and Facebook, revealed a ticker at the bottom of CNN’s screen with the poll question, “Should Governor Newsom get recalled?” At first, the number was 4.5 million “no” along with 2.2 million “yes.” Just moments later, the ticker’s number of “yes” went down to 1.9 million.

GOP commentators questioned why the 351,000 votes were “DELETED,” and said the clip was proof of fraud and said it showed Gov. Newsom only kept his office due to machine glitches.

But Democrats report that the votes, which were cast inside a digital and automated machine, were changed due to a manual “reporting” error by a staffer at the county office inside Santa Clara.
